C Send unicast Neighbor Adverlisement
trong trường hợp cả hai loại địa chỉ được trả về thì trật tự sắp xếp các loại địa chỉ
liên quan đến luồng IP đối với host đó. Nếu một địa chỉ IPv6 được trả về, node
đó giao tiếp với node đích trong đó các gói tin được đóng gói theo chuẩn IPvó6. Nếu địa chỉ IPv4 được trả về thì node đó giao tiếp với một node IPv4.
Cơ chế Tunneling giữa IPv6vàIPv4 -72-
3.2.2. Cơ chế IPv6 tunnel qua IPv4 (Cơ chế Tunneling)
3.2.2.1 Giới thiệu chung
Cơ cổ hạ tầng mạng Ïnternet hoạt động trên nền IPv4, hoạt động khả ôn định
và có qui mô rộng lớn. Tận dụng khả năng này các nhà thiết kế IPv6 đã đưa ra giải pháp là thực hiện cơ chế Tunneling (đường hằm) trên nền mạng IPv4.
Có hai loại Tunneling sau:
Tunneling cài đặt (Configured Tunneling). Tunneling tự động (Automatic Tunneling). Một số khái niệm liên quan đến quá trình Tunneling:
IPv4-only node: là một host/router hoạt động trên nền IPv4, các
host/router này không hiểu IPv6, các host này chiếm phần lớn các
thiết bị trên mạng Internet hiện nay. Ta gọi các nodes này là node
thuần IPv4.
IPv4/IPv6 node: là các nodes có khả năng thực hiện trên nền IPv4
hoặc IPv6. Ta gọi các node này là node đôi.
IPv6-only node: là các node chỉ có khả năng hoạt động trên nền
1Pv6, không có khả năng thực hiện trên nền IPv4. Ta ĐỌI các nodes
này là các node thuần IPv6.
IPv6 nođe: là các nodes sau: node thuần IPx6; node đôi IPv4/IPv6. IPv4 node: là các nodes sau: node thuần IPx4:; node đôi IPv4/IPvó6.
[Pv4-compatible IPv6 address: là một địa chỉ IPvó được gán cho các
node đôi IPv4/IPvó. Ta gọi địa chỉ IPv6 loại này là địa chỉ IPv6
tương thích IPv4. Địa chỉ này được sử dụng trong cơ chế tunnel IPv6 trên nền IPv4.
IPv6-only address: là các dạng địa chỉ [Pv6 còn lại.
IPv6-over-IPv4 tunneling: kỹ thuật này thực hiện việc đóng gói các datagram theo cấu trúc IPv6 vào phần dữ liệu của datagram IPv4 để có thể mang các gói tin IPv6 qua mạng IPv4, ta gọi cơ chế này là Tunnel IPv6 trên nền IPv4. Có hai loại tunnel là: Confñgured Tunneling và Automatie Tunneling. Được định nghĩa như sau:
Cơ chế Tunneling giữa IPv6 vàIPv4 -73-
e© Configured Tunneling: thì địa chỉ cuối cùng có tunnel được xác định
nhờ thông tin cấu hình tại các nodes đóng gói.
e© Automatic Tunneling: thì địa chỉ cuối cùng có tunnel là địa chí IPv6 tương thích với địa chỉ IPv4.
Cơ chế Tunneling được mô tả như sau: Các nodes [Pv4/IPv6 sẽ thực hiện đóng gói các datagram IPv6 vào thành phần dữ liệu trong datagram IPv4 (phần tải trọng của gói tin IPv4 truyền trên mạng là gói tin IPv6), do đó gói tin này sẽ có thể truyền qua mạng trên nên IPv4.
IPv6 node : : | : IPv§ node
Đóng gói : IPv4 Router |Pv4 Router Mở cói tỉ ở gói tin tin Tunnel
L_ __—] L__ —]
Hình 3.3: Cơ chế Tunneling
Các kết nối có thể áp dụng cơ chế Tunneling là:
e_ Router-fo-Router: Các router [Pv4/IPv6 kết nối với nhau bởi cơ sở hạ tầng IPv4, do đó có thể thực hiện chuyển các đatagram IPv6 qua cơ
chế tunnel. Trong trường hợp này cơ chế tunnel trái rộng từ điểm bắt